MADISON, N.J. – Sophomore
Beth Kelly made 11 saves, but the Drew University field hockey team was handed a 5-0 setback by Widener University in a non-conference outing Saturday afternoon in Ranger Stadium.
Â
The Pride (2-2) scored one goal in each of the first three quarters before adding a pair of tallies in the fourth period. Five different players scored a goal for the visitors.
Â
Kelly exceeded her previous career-high save total by six stops. She turned aside five shots in the first quarter and three apiece in the third and fourth quarters.
Â
The Rangers return home on Tuesday, when they take on Eastern University at 7 p.m. in a tune-up for their Landmark Conference opener next Saturday at Susquehanna University.
